From: Borislav Petkov <bp@suse.de>
When using perf stat on an AMD F15h system with the default hw events
attributes, some of the events don't get counted:
Performance counter stats for 'sleep 1':
0.749208 task-clock (msec) # 0.001 CPUs utilized
1 context-switches # 0.001 M/sec
0 cpu-migrations # 0.000 K/sec
54 page-faults # 0.072 M/sec
1,122,815 cycles # 1.499 GHz
286,740 stalled-cycles-frontend # 25.54% frontend cycles idle
<not counted> stalled-cycles-backend (0.00%)
^^^^^^^^^^^^
<not counted> instructions (0.00%)
^^^^^^^^^^^^
<not counted> branches (0.00%)
<not counted> branch-misses (0.00%)
1.001550070 seconds time elapsed
The reason is that we have the HW watchdog consuming one PMU counter and
when perf tries to schedule 6 events on 6 counters and some of those
counters are constrained to only a specific subset of PMCs by the
hardware, the event scheduling fails.
So issue a hint to disable the HW watchdog around a perf stat session.
Committer note:
Testing it...
# perf stat -d usleep 1
Performance counter stats for 'usleep 1':
1.180203 task-clock (msec) # 0.490 CPUs utilized
1 context-switches # 0.847 K/sec
0 cpu-migrations # 0.000 K/sec
54 page-faults # 0.046 M/sec
184,754 cycles # 0.157 GHz
714,553 instructions # 3.87 insn per cycle
154,661 branches # 131.046 M/sec
7,247 branch-misses # 4.69% of all branches
219,984 L1-dcache-loads # 186.395 M/sec
17,600 L1-dcache-load-misses # 8.00% of all L1-dcache hits (90.16%)
<not counted> LLC-loads (0.00%)
<not counted> LLC-load-misses (0.00%)
0.002406823 seconds time elapsed
Some events weren't counted. Try disabling the NMI watchdog:
echo 0 > /proc/sys/kernel/nmi_watchdog
perf stat ...
echo 1 > /proc/sys/kernel/nmi_watchdog

From: "Naveen N. Rao" <naveen.n.rao@linux.vnet.ibm.com>
Since the kernel includes many non-global functions with same names, we
will need to use offsets from other symbols (typically _text/_stext) or
absolute addresses to place return probes on specific functions. Also,
the core register_kretprobe() API never forbid use of offsets or
absolute addresses with kretprobes.
Allow its use with the trace infrastructure. To distinguish kernels that
support this, update ftrace README to explicitly call this out.

diff --git a/tools/include/linux/refcount.h b/tools/include/linux/refcount.h
new file mode 100644
index 000000000000..a0177c1f55b1
--- /dev/null
+++ b/tools/include/linux/refcount.h
@@ -0,0 +1,151 @@
+#ifndef _TOOLS_LINUX_REFCOUNT_H
+#define _TOOLS_LINUX_REFCOUNT_H
+
+/*
+ * Variant of atomic_t specialized for reference counts.
+ *
+ * The interface matches the atomic_t interface (to aid in porting) but only
+ * provides the few functions one should use for reference counting.
+ *
+ * It differs in that the counter saturates at UINT_MAX and will not move once
+ * there. This avoids wrapping the counter and causing 'spurious'
+ * use-after-free issues.
+ *
+ * Memory ordering rules are slightly relaxed wrt regular atomic_t functions
+ * and provide only what is strictly required for refcounts.
+ *
+ * The increments are fully relaxed; these will not provide ordering. The
+ * rationale is that whatever is used to obtain the object we're increasing the
+ * reference count on will provide the ordering. For locked data structures,
+ * its the lock acquire, for RCU/lockless data structures its the dependent
+ * load.
+ *
+ * Do note that inc_not_zero() provides a control dependency which will order
+ * future stores against the inc, this ensures we'll never modify the object
+ * if we did not in fact acquire a reference.
+ *
+ * The decrements will provide release order, such that all the prior loads and
+ * stores will be issued before, it also provides a control dependency, which
+ * will order us against the subsequent free().
+ *
+ * The control dependency is against the load of the cmpxchg (ll/sc) that
+ * succeeded. This means the stores aren't fully ordered, but this is fine
+ * because the 1->0 transition indicates no concurrency.
+ *
+ * Note that the allocator is responsible for ordering things between free()
+ * and alloc().
+ *
+ */
+
+#include <linux/atomic.h>
+#include <linux/kernel.h>
+
+#ifdef NDEBUG
+#define REFCOUNT_WARN(cond, str) (void)(cond)
+#define __refcount_check
+#else
+#define REFCOUNT_WARN(cond, str) BUG_ON(cond)
+#define __refcount_check __must_check
+#endif
+
+typedef struct refcount_struct {
+ atomic_t refs;
+} refcount_t;
+
+#define REFCOUNT_INIT(n) { .refs = ATOMIC_INIT(n), }
+
+static inline void refcount_set(refcount_t *r, unsigned int n)
+{
+ atomic_set(&r->refs, n);
+}
+
+static inline unsigned int refcount_read(const refcount_t *r)
+{
+ return atomic_read(&r->refs);
+}
+
+/*
+ * Similar to atomic_inc_not_zero(), will saturate at UINT_MAX and WARN.
+ *
+ * Provides no memory ordering, it is assumed the caller has guaranteed the
+ * object memory to be stable (RCU, etc.). It does provide a control dependency
+ * and thereby orders future stores. See the comment on top.
+ */
+static inline __refcount_check
+bool refcount_inc_not_zero(refcount_t *r)
+{
+ unsigned int old, new, val = atomic_read(&r->refs);
+
+ for (;;) {
+ new = val + 1;
+
+ if (!val)
+ return false;
+
+ if (unlikely(!new))
+ return true;
+
+ old = atomic_cmpxchg_relaxed(&r->refs, val, new);
+ if (old == val)
+ break;
+
+ val = old;
+ }
+
+ REFCOUNT_WARN(new == UINT_MAX, "refcount_t: saturated; leaking memory.\n");
+
+ return true;
+}
+
+/*
+ * Similar to atomic_inc(), will saturate at UINT_MAX and WARN.
+ *
+ * Provides no memory ordering, it is assumed the caller already has a
+ * reference on the object, will WARN when this is not so.
+ */
+static inline void refcount_inc(refcount_t *r)
+{
+ REFCOUNT_WARN(!refcount_inc_not_zero(r), "refcount_t: increment on 0; use-after-free.\n");
+}
+
+/*
+ * Similar to atomic_dec_and_test(), it will WARN on underflow and fail to
+ * decrement when saturated at UINT_MAX.
+ *
+ * Provides release memory ordering, such that prior loads and stores are done
+ * before, and provides a control dependency such that free() must come after.
+ * See the comment on top.
+ */
+static inline __refcount_check
+bool refcount_sub_and_test(unsigned int i, refcount_t *r)
+{
+ unsigned int old, new, val = atomic_read(&r->refs);
+
+ for (;;) {
+ if (unlikely(val == UINT_MAX))
+ return false;
+
+ new = val - i;
+ if (new > val) {
+ REFCOUNT_WARN(new > val, "refcount_t: underflow; use-after-free.\n");
+ return false;
+ }
+
+ old = atomic_cmpxchg_release(&r->refs, val, new);
+ if (old == val)
+ break;
+
+ val = old;
+ }
+
+ return !new;
+}
+
+static inline __refcount_check
+bool refcount_dec_and_test(refcount_t *r)
+{
+ return refcount_sub_and_test(1, r);
+}
+
+
+#endif /* _ATOMIC_LINUX_REFCOUNT_H */

From: Arnaldo Carvalho de Melo <acme@redhat.com> When build with: 'make CC=clang' we were not using that CC to do feature detection, which resulted in features being detected with gcc and then the actual tools being built with clang. Most of the time these compilers are compatible enough, so no problem was being noticed. As soon as a system with an old enough clang, one that hasn't the cpuid.h header is used, and a gcc with it, the "get_cpuid" feature will be found available but then code that will use can't be compiled.
